Hi everyone, I have posted in the main forum about my enrollment in the herceptin dm1 trial and now I'm posting here (I am a Libra after all-just balancing it out). I went to Denver today for my first week's follow up blood work and Zometa. I really didn't ask about the blood work drawn the day I started and don't know much about todays' draws. What I do know is that I have some thrombocytopenia. Which looks like a pretty common side effect. I just hope the platelets rally before I am due for the next dose. Otherwise I feel pretty good. A little tired, but that can be for so many reasons. I had a continuous headache on day 1 through about 4 that I think was related. Have one now, but I feel like it is something else (probably cleaning the house. So not much of an update, but something to share anyway. If anyone has any experience with platelets improving over 3 week intervals I would love to hear about it.

The thrombocytopenia (I bet we never knew we'd know THAT word when we were in school!) is totally to be expected and rebounds really quickly. Mine bounced way back up by day 15 and have so far always been back in the normal range by day 21. So if you were going to make someone else chop the veggies (since you shouldn't be playing with knives in your delicate state) you better do it this week!

I also had flulike symptoms for about 3 days after my first infusion. Fever, headache, tired. After a few treatments I no longer get the fever or headache but I still do feel tired for a week or 2!

But I think you should stop cleaning the house since I'm sure that's probably giving you a headache.

How are your liver function levels? That's been my biggest problem with the trial, but I am told that I'm unusual (although I prefer the term "special") in that regard.
